Removing leaves helps address several common property concerns. Accumulated leaves can create slippery surfaces on walkways and driveways, increasing the risk of slips and falls. Additionally, thick layers of leaves can smother grass and garden beds, leading to potential damage or disease. Leaf debris can also clog gutters and drainage systems if not promptly removed, which may cause water pooling or damage during storms. Regular leaf removal can help preserve the health and safety of outdoor spaces while maintaining a neat appearance.

Cost Range - Leaf removal services typically cost between $150 and $400 for residential properties, depending on the size and number of trees. Larger yards or extensive leaf coverage may increase the price. Prices vary based on local service providers and specific job requirements.
Pricing Factors - The cost of leaf removal can depend on the number of trees, yard size, and leaf volume. For example, a small yard with a few trees might cost around $150, while larger properties could be charged up to $500. Service providers may charge per hour or per job, leading to different total costs.
Average Costs - On average, homeowners in Clark County, WA, might pay approximately $200 to $350 for seasonal leaf removal. Costs can fluctuate based on the complexity of the job and local market rates. It’s common for providers to offer free estimates to determine specific costs.
Additional Expenses - Some providers may charge extra for bagging leaves or hauling away debris, which can add $50 to $100 to the total cost.
